How It Works
Original Turbo Decoder HU100 Features
The original Turbo Decoder HU100 includes these main parts:
- Key Profile – Designed for opening and decoding HU100 door and ignition locks used in Opel, GM, Vauxhall, and Chevrolet vehicles.
- Sliding Pins – Used to open the lock and read the lock code.
- Pin Bar – Helps insert and remove the tool smoothly.
- Tension Wheel – Applies turning pressure during unlocking.
- Pin Activator Wheel – Controls movement of the pin bars.
- Turbo Wheel – Moves the pins to match the lock code.
Before Use
For best results:
- Clean the lock using WD40 to remove dirt or dust.
- Confirm the vehicle uses the HU100 key profile.
- Make sure the lock is original and not a low-quality replacement.
Lock Direction Check
HU100 locks can be left or right side.
- Insert the tool fully into the lock.
- Push the turbo wheel forward.
- If it moves deeper, remove it, flip it, and try again.
- If correct, the tool will stay firm inside the lock.
Opening Instructions
- Hold the tool from the activator ring.
- Turn the turbo wheel fully right.
- Insert fully into the lock.
- Pull back the activator wheel until positions 3, 2, 1 appear.
- Apply left turning pressure.
- Turn the turbo wheel left to stop point 1.
- Return right and release pressure.
- Repeat left and right pressure for 20 cycles.
If still locked:
- Move to stop point 2 and repeat 20 cycles.
If still not open:
- Move to stop point 3 and repeat 10 more cycles.
Decoding the Lock
Once opened:
- Turn the lock left or right.
- Keep light pressure applied.
- Pump once to stop point 3.
- Gently move the tool along the blade line.
- The lock code transfers to the pins.
Safe Removal
- Return lock to neutral position.
- Turn turbo wheel fully left.
- Push activator wheel fully forward.
- Remove the tool carefully.
Reading the Code
- Pull back the activator wheel.
- Turn turbo wheel to stop point 3 or 4.
- Read the visible pins in order.
This lock has 8 discs, with cuts 1, 2, 3, or 4.
Example code: 11223312
Use the code in your key cutting machine to make a replacement key.
Resetting Pins
Before next use:
- Turn turbo wheel to stop point 1.
- Pull activator back.
- Use HU100 reset tool.
- Press each pin gently back into place.
Do not use excessive force. Pins move easily.
